.loading-overlay[data-v-5b62f3c3]{backdrop-filter:blur(2px);z-index:9999;background-color:#002d3d99;justify-content:center;align-items:center;width:100%;height:100%;display:flex;position:fixed;top:0;left:0}.loading-content[data-v-5b62f3c3]{text-align:center;color:#fff}.spinner[data-v-5b62f3c3]{border:4px solid #ffffff40;border-top-color:var(--blue);border-radius:50%;width:40px;height:40px;margin:0 auto;animation:1s linear infinite spin-5b62f3c3}.loading-message[data-v-5b62f3c3]{margin-top:16px;font-size:16px;font-weight:500}@keyframes spin-5b62f3c3{to{transform:rotate(360deg)}}.fade-enter-active[data-v-5b62f3c3],.fade-leave-active[data-v-5b62f3c3]{transition:opacity .3s}.fade-enter-from[data-v-5b62f3c3],.fade-leave-to[data-v-5b62f3c3]{opacity:0}
